One of the standout PSP titles is Grand Theft Auto: Vice City Stories. Set in the iconic Vice City, this game offered players the freedom to explore a massive open world while engaging in the usual mayhem the Grand Theft Auto series is known for. Vice City Stories featured an engaging story about power struggles and betrayal, and its open-world gameplay allowed players to engage in everything from car chases to side missions. Despite being on a handheld console, it managed to capture the same chaotic energy as the console versions, making it one of the most iconic PSP games.

Another incredible title for the PSP is Final Fantasy Tactics: The War of the Lions. This turn-based strategy game offers a rich and engaging storyline, paired with complex tactical battles. Players control a group of soldiers in a political conflict, making decisions that impact the outcome of the story. With its deep tactical combat system, branching storylines, and well-developed characters, Final Fantasy Tactics became a beloved RPG on the PSP. Fans of strategy games and the Final Fantasy franchise still fondly remember this title as one of the best PSP experiences.

Metal Gear Solid: Peace Walker is another game that demonstrated the PSP’s ability to deliver console-quality experiences. A direct sequel to Metal Gear Solid 3: Snake Eater, Peace Walker follows Big Boss as he builds his army in a political conflict in Latin America. The game introduced new gameplay mechanics, such as base-building and cooperative multiplayer, which added depth to the already engaging Metal Gear formula. The game’s storytelling, combined with its stealth-based gameplay and compelling narrative, made it a standout title for the PSP and one of the best entries in the Metal Gear series.

For fans of rhythm games, Patapon was a unique and addictive experience that stood out among the many PSP titles. Players control a tribe of creatures known as Patapons, directing them through rhythmic commands to defeat enemies and overcome obstacles. The game’s charming art style, catchy music, and engaging gameplay mechanics made it a standout title in the PSP library. Its simplicity, combined with its strategic depth, ensured that Patapon remains a fan favorite to this day.

Finally, God of War: Chains of Olympus brought the brutal combat and mythological storytelling of the God of War franchise to the PSP. The game offered an exciting and action-packed experience, with players taking control of Kratos as he battles through Greek mythology to save the world. The game’s epic scale, combined with smooth combat and stunning visuals, showcased the PSP’s potential and made it one of the most memorable titles on the system.
